Kia launches three new electric GT vehicles in Korea, starting at $37,000

Kia introduced a series of new electric GT vehicles in Korea. The EV3 GT, EV4 GT, and EV5 GT are the latest to join Kia’s growing performance EV lineup.

Kia unleashes a slew of new electric GT vehicles

After unveiling the new electric sports cars at the Brussels Motor Show last month, Kia’s latest EVs are now available in Korea.

Kia launched the EV3 GT, EV4 GT, and EV5 GT on Monday, adding to its growing lineup of electric performance cars.

The new GT models are equipped with a dual-wheel-drive (AWD) pin system, GT-exclusive interior and exterior design elements, and added features, transforming an ordinary performance-driving machine.

The EV3 and EV4 GT are equipped with a 145 kW front motor and a 70 kW rear motor, delivering a combined 215 kW.

Meanwhile, the EV5 GT features a larger 155 kW front motor and the same 70 kW rear motor, for a combined 225 kW output.

All new models feature Kia’s signature neon-colored brake calipers, 20″ wheels and performance tires, GT-modified front and rear bumpers, and GT-exclusive badging.

On the interior, you’ll find more GT-exclusive elements, including sports seats and a unique driver-cluster screen, along with premium features such as a Harman Kardon stereo system.

Beyond the exterior, Kia added new features, including a virtual gearshift system and Active Sound (e-ASD), which simulates the sound and shift feel of a high-performance engine.

The EV3 GT is priced at 53.75 million won ($37,000), the EV4 GT at 55.17 million won ($38,000), and the EV5 GT at 56.6 million won ($39,000).

Kia is offering a trade-in program with up to 700,000 won ($500) discount for those who upgrade to a new electric vehicle.

For owners of a Sorento or Carnival, Kia is offering an additional 1 million won ($700) bonus when purchasing an EV9, bringing the combined discount to 1.7 million won ($1,200).

After launching in Korea, Kia is expected to introduce the EV3 GT, EV4 GT, and EV5 GT in Europe, the UK, and other global markets throughout 2026.
